> On Jun 29, 2015, at 3:32 PM, Martin Jansa <[email protected]> wrote: > > On Mon, Jun 29, 2015 at 02:23:50PM -0400, Drew Moseley wrote: >> Fixes warnings such as: >> WARNING: mesa: invalid PACKAGECONFIG: r600 >> when building with the r600 configuration. > > Shouldn't you fix your PACKAGECONFIG value instead (wherever it's set to > include r600)?
It’s very possible that this is not the best solution for the warning. The line that sets the GALLIUMDRIVERS_LLVM33 variable right above the line I added is ultimately what I’m trying to have behave properly. Previously setting PACKAGECONFIG+=“r600” was sufficient to enable this setting but with commit hash c2cbe0f60e6d19ab9a8321be74d636d2c36671a8 this now throws a warning. Any suggestions for a cleaner solution?
